Soak yellow split pigeon pea lentils in enough water for 15-20 minutes.
½ cup Toor Dal, As reqd Water
Once soaked, pressure cook the lentils until they are completely cooked and turn soft.
While the dal is getting cooked, heat oil in a pan. Add the cumin seeds, mustard seeds, curry leaves, and dry red chilies and saute.
1 tsp Oil, ½ tsp Mustard seeds, ½ tsp Cumin seeds, 3-4 Pcs Curry leaves, 1-2 pcs Dry red chili
Next, add the chopped green chilies, onions, and tomatoes. Saute for 1-2 minutes.
1 tsp Green chilies, ½ cup Onions, ¼ cup Tomatoes
Add the ginger garlic paste next and saute.
1 tsp Ginger garlic paste
Add the powdered spices and mix. Let it cook for a minute.
½ tsp Turmeric powder, 2 tsp Red chili powder, 2 tsp Coriander powder, 1 tsp Cumin powder, 2 tsp Salt
Next, add the cooked lentils and mix well.
Sprinkle garam masala powder on the lentil mixture and mix.
1 tsp Garam masala
Add a few drops of lemon juice to the lentil mixture and mix well.
1 tsp Lemon juice
Serve hot with steamed rice and sabzi of your choice after garnishing with freshly chopped coriander leaves.
For garnish Coriander leaves
